Function and application in the suspension system
The rear left wheel carrier and hub in a Mercedes W203 is a key element connecting the suspension, braking system, and wheel. It is responsible for:
- stable mounting of the hub and wheel bearing,
- maintaining the correct rear axle suspension geometry,
- secure connection with control arms and other suspension components,
- proper wheel guidance throughout the entire range of suspension travel.
Thanks to its precise fit for the W203 design, this component allows for the preservation of factory handling parameters and ride comfort, which is particularly important in premium class vehicles.

Practical installation and maintenance tips
When replacing the wheel carrier and hub, it is recommended to simultaneously check the condition of the wheel bearing, control arms, bushings, and mounting hardware. After installation, it is necessary to align the rear axle geometry to fully utilize the potential of the newly installed component and avoid uneven tire wear. A properly selected and installed wheel carrier affects:
- driving stability at higher speeds,
- handling confidence in corners,
- ride comfort on uneven surfaces.
